Reading Labels Is a Skill Worth Developing

Label reading sounds simple enough, but in practice, it can be genuinely confusing. Ingredient names are often long, technical, and difficult to pronounce. Lists can run for dozens of entries. Some ingredients appear under multiple names depending on the manufacturer. None of this is accidental. The more complicated a label looks, the less likely most people are to engage with it.

But developing even a basic familiarity with what to look for makes a real difference. Here is what ingredient-aware label reading actually involves:

  • Recognizing which types of additives are generally considered safe versus which ones have raised questions among health researchers.
  • Understanding that the same ingredient can appear under different names across different brands.
  • Knowing that ingredients are typically listed in order of concentration, with the highest amounts appearing first.
  • Spotting filler ingredients that add bulk or fragrance without serving any functional purpose.

Start small. Pick one product category and spend time understanding its common ingredients. Over time, that knowledge compounds.

Everyday Products Carry More Exposure Than People Realize

Most people think about ingredient awareness in the context of food. What gets overlooked is the sheer volume of non-food products that come into contact with the body every single day. Lotions, shampoos, deodorants, cleaning sprays, laundry detergents, and even scented candles continuously introduce substances into the immediate environment.

The skin absorbs. The lungs breathe. Children crawl on freshly cleaned floors and put their hands in their mouths. These are not causes for panic, but they are legitimate reasons to think carefully about what gets used at home. A single exposure to any given chemical may mean very little. But repeated exposure over years and decades is a different conversation entirely, and one that ingredient awareness helps navigate.

Why “Natural” Does Not Always Mean Safe

One of the most common misconceptions about ingredient awareness is the assumption that natural equals harmless. This is a comfortable idea, but it does not hold up. There are plenty of naturally occurring substances that are harmful to humans, just as there are synthetic compounds that have been rigorously tested and proven safe. The distinction between natural and synthetic tells you far less than you might expect.

What actually matters is whether an ingredient has been tested, at what concentrations it is used, and how it interacts with other components in a formula. Ingredient awareness means moving past the natural versus synthetic framing and asking more useful questions. Has this been evaluated for safety? Is the concentration appropriate? Are there known sensitivities or risks associated with long-term use?
